Mission
Statement
Students for Life of Michigan (SFLM)
is an organization of pro-life college students formed
to promote a culture of life on college campuses in Michigan.
We serve as a resource for pro-life college students, as
we work to form new Students for Life groups on campus
and build communication among existing groups in Michigan.
We also aim to raise awareness about pregnancy, parenting,
and adoption resources available to college students, as
well as support for those suffering from an abortion experience.

Board of Directors
Katie Wilcox - Chair
Katie Wilcox is currently a student at Ave Maria School of Law in Ann Arbor, Michigan, where she serves as Vice President of the Lex Vitae Society, Republican National Lawyers Association, and Italian American Lawyers Society. Most recently, Katie served as Chair of Michigan Students for Brownback and looks forward to being a summer associate at a law firm in Lansing this summer.
Katie began her involvement in the pro-life movement as a volunteer for Right to Life of Michigan during her junior year of high school. She subsequently founded the Students for Life club at Lansing Catholic High School. In college, Katie planned the first statewide pro-life rally at Michigan State University as a freshman and became Co-President of Michigan State University Students for Life (MSU SFL) that year. She then served as President of MSU SFL for two years, before founding Students for Life of Michigan (SFLM) as a senior in college and serving as President of SFLM during its first year of existence. Katie also held a position as an Outreach Director for Students for Life of America for two years. Throughout college, Katie held leadership positions in several political student organizations, participated in numerous campaigns for pro-life politicians, and interned for pro-life elected officials. Katie currently serves as Chair of the SFLM Board of Directors.
